Show One’s Hand 1100 Words You Need Week 10 Day 3

to reveal one’s intentions, make your decision or intentions clear, allow people to know about your true intentions after you’ve concealed them, let the cat out of the bag, spill the beans, confess:

As a naive person, I should eat humble pie and admit that I showed my hand to my fair-weather friends too soon.

antonym: keep secret, suppress, keep under wraps, keep under your hat, keep to yourself

French: révéler vos intentions

Farsi: اهداف خود را آشکار کنید

